In 1820, Giles Dunn entered the world in Blount, Tennessee, born to Daniel Dunn And Susannah Parman. Giles Dunn married Mary Josephine Stevens, Sidney Josephine Walker, and had children including Daniel Dunn, Elizabeth Dunn, Hetty H Dunn, Joseph P Dunn, Levi Dunn, Mary A Dunn, Sidney Josephine Dunn, Susan S Dunn, William Houston Dunn. Giles Dunn passed away in 1913 in Altogo, Collin, Texas.
